Context Readings

Israel's Adultery Forgiven

18 And in that day I will make a covenant for them with the beasts of the field, and with the birds of the heavens, and with the creeping things of the ground. And I will break the bow and the sword and the battle out of the land, and 19 And I will betroth thee to me forever. Yea, I will betroth thee to me in righteousness, and in justice, and in loving kindness, and in mercies. 20 I will even betroth thee to me in faithfulness, and thou shall know LORD.
